@charset "utf-8";
/* CSS Document */

@media screen and (max-width:768px){
	#wrap{
		width:100%;
		}
	header{
		width:100%;
		}
	header h2{
		font-size:38px;
		padding-top:3.611111111111111111111111111111%;
		padding-bottom:3.75%;
		}
			
	.back{
		left:4.444444444444444444444444444444%;
		top:27.083333333333333333333333333333%;
		width:3.194444444444444444444444444444%;
		}	

	.datu{
		width:100%;
		padding:1.666666666666666666666666666667% 0;
		
		}
	.datu img{
		width:100%;	
		}
	
.Recommend .video ul .v1-play{
	padding-right:3.910614525139664804469273743017%;
	padding-left:5.027932960893854748603351955307%;
	padding-bottom:5.586592178770949720670391061453%;
	}		
.Recommend .video ul .v1-play .play{
	width:100%;
	}	



.Recommend .shortline img{
	width:0.5555555555555556%;
	top:18px;
	}
	
.Recommend h3{
	font-size:28px;
	padding-left:4.444444444444%;
	padding-top:2.5%;
	padding-bottom:2.5%;
	}	

.Recommend .video ul .v1-img a{
	padding:0;
	
	}
.Recommend .video ul{
	width:49.722222222222222222222222222222%;
	}	
	
		
.Recommend .video ul li img{
	width:100%;
	}		
	
.Recommend .video ul .v1-name a{
	font-size:24px;
	padding-left:5.027932960893854748603351955307%;
	padding-top:4.469273743016759776536312849162%;
	padding-bottom:3.351955307262569832402234636872%;
	}
	
.Recommend .video ul .v1-times{
	font-size:22px;
	color:#999999;
	font-weight:lighter;
	line-height:22px;
	}
	
	
.video1-1{
	margin-right:0.555555555555555555555555555556%;
	
	}	




.v1-name{
	width:100%;
	
	}


.time{
	right:1.117318435754189944134078212291%;
	top:56.930355198806793023201616688917%;
	width:20.670391061452513966480446927374%;
	
	}
.time-num{
	right:1.117318435754189944134078212291%;
	top:56.930355198806793023201616688917%;
	width:20.670391061452513966480446927374%;
	
	}	


.Recommend .video ul li .time-bg{
	width:100%;
	}	
.Recommend .video ul .time-num{
	font-size:19px;
	}	




}



@media screen and (max-width:480px){
	#wrap{
		width:100%;
		}
	header{
		width:100%;
		}
header h2{
	font-size:24px;
	padding-top:3.611111111111111111111111111111%;
	padding-bottom:3.75%;
	}
		
.back{
	left:4.444444444444444444444444444444%;
	top:27.083333333333333333333333333333%;
	width:3.194444444444444444444444444444%;
	}	


	.datu{
		width:100%;
		padding:1.666666666666666666666666666667% 0;
		
		}
	.datu img{
		width:100%;	
		}

.Recommend .shortline img{
	width:0.5555555555555556%;
	top:12px;
	}
	
.Recommend h3{
	font-size:18px;
	padding-left:4.444444444444%;
	padding-top:2.5%;
	padding-bottom:2.5%;
	}	

.Recommend .video ul .v1-img a{
	padding:0;
	
	}
.Recommend .video ul{
	width:49.722222222222222222222222222222%;
	}	
	
		
.Recommend .video ul li img{
	width:100%;
	}		





	
	
.Recommend .video ul .v1-play{
	padding-right:3.910614525139664804469273743017%;
	padding-left:5.027932960893854748603351955307%;
	padding-bottom:5.586592178770949720670391061453%;
	}		
.Recommend .video ul .v1-play .play{
	width:76%;
	}	
	




	
.Recommend .video ul .v1-name a{
	font-size:15px;
	padding-left:5.027932960893854748603351955307%;
	padding-top:4.469273743016759776536312849162%;
	padding-bottom:3.351955307262569832402234636872%;
	}
	
.Recommend .video ul .v1-times{
	font-size:13px;
	color:#999999;
	font-weight:lighter;
	line-height:13px;
	}
	
	
.video1-1{
	margin-right:0.555555555555555555555555555556%;
	
	}


.v1-name{
	width:100%;
	
	}



.time{
	right:1.117318435754189944134078212291%;
	top:56.930355198806793023201616688917%;
	width:20.670391061452513966480446927374%;
	
	}
.time-num{
	right:1.117318435754189944134078212291%;
	top:56.930355198806793023201616688917%;
	width:20.670391061452513966480446927374%;
	
	}	


.Recommend .video ul li .time-bg{
	width:100%;
	}	
.Recommend .video ul .time-num{
	font-size:12px;
	}	


}




@media screen and (max-width:360px){
	#wrap{
		width:100%;
		}
	header{
		width:100%;
		}
header h2{
	font-size:18px;
	padding-top:3.611111111111111111111111111111%;
	padding-bottom:3.75%;
	}
		
.back{
	left:4.444444444444444444444444444444%;
	top:27.083333333333333333333333333333%;
	width:3.194444444444444444444444444444%;
	}	


	.datu{
		width:100%;
		padding:1.666666666666666666666666666667% 0;
		
		}
	.datu img{
		width:100%;	
		}




.Recommend .shortline img{
	width:0.5555555555555556%;
	top:8px;
	}
	
.Recommend h3{
	font-size:13px;
	padding-left:4.444444444444%;
	padding-top:2.5%;
	padding-bottom:2.5%;
	}	

.Recommend .video ul .v1-img a{
	padding:0;
	
	}
.Recommend .video ul{
	width:49.722222222222222222222222222222%;
	}	
	
		
.Recommend .video ul li img{
	width:100%;
	}		





	
	
.Recommend .video ul .v1-play{
	padding-right:3.910614525139664804469273743017%;
	padding-left:5.027932960893854748603351955307%;
	padding-bottom:5.586592178770949720670391061453%;
	}		
.Recommend .video ul .v1-play .play{
	width:66%;
	}	
	




	
.Recommend .video ul .v1-name a{
	font-size:12px;
	padding-left:5.027932960893854748603351955307%;
	padding-top:4.469273743016759776536312849162%;
	padding-bottom:3.351955307262569832402234636872%;
	}
	
.Recommend .video ul .v1-times{
	font-size:11px;
	color:#999999;
	font-weight:lighter;
	line-height:13px;
	}
	
	
.video1-1{
	margin-right:0.555555555555555555555555555556%;
	
	}
	


.v1-name{
	width:100%;
	
	}



.time{
	right:1.117318435754189944134078212291%;
	top:56.930355198806793023201616688917%;
	width:20.670391061452513966480446927374%;
	
	}
.time-num{
	right:1.117318435754189944134078212291%;
	top:57.930355198806793023201616688917%;
	width:20.670391061452513966480446927374%;
	
	}	




.Recommend .video ul li .time-bg{
	width:100%;
	}	
.Recommend .video ul .time-num{
	font-size:9px;
	}
}


@media screen and (max-width:320px){
	#wrap{
		width:100%;
		}
	header{
		width:100%;
		}
header h2{
	font-size:16px;
	padding-top:3.611111111111111111111111111111%;
	padding-bottom:3.75%;
	}
		
.back{
	left:4.444444444444444444444444444444%;
	top:27.083333333333333333333333333333%;
	width:3.194444444444444444444444444444%;
	}	


	.datu{
		width:100%;
		padding:1.666666666666666666666666666667% 0;
		
		}
	.datu img{
		width:100%;	
		}

.Recommend .shortline img{
	width:0.5555555555555556%;
	top:7px;
	}
	
.Recommend h3{
	font-size:12px;
	padding-left:4.444444444444%;
	padding-top:2.5%;
	padding-bottom:2.5%;
	}	

.Recommend .video ul .v1-img a{
	padding:0;
	
	}
.Recommend .video ul{
	width:49.722222222222222222222222222222%;
	}	
	
		
.Recommend .video ul li img{
	width:100%;
	}		





	
	
.Recommend .video ul .v1-play{
	padding-right:3.910614525139664804469273743017%;
	padding-left:5.027932960893854748603351955307%;
	padding-bottom:5.586592178770949720670391061453%;
	}		
.Recommend .video ul .v1-play .play{
	width:56%;
	}	
	




	
.Recommend .video ul .v1-name a{
	font-size:10px;
	padding-left:5.027932960893854748603351955307%;
	padding-top:4.469273743016759776536312849162%;
	padding-bottom:3.351955307262569832402234636872%;
	}
	
.Recommend .video ul .v1-times{
	font-size:9px;
	color:#999999;
	font-weight:lighter;
	line-height:13px;
	}
	
	
.video1-1{
	margin-right:0.555555555555555555555555555556%;
	
	}
.v1-name{
	width:100%;
	
	}



.time{
	right:1.117318435754189944134078212291%;
	top:55.930355198806793023201616688917%;
	width:20.670391061452513966480446927374%;
	
	}
.time-num{
	right:1.117318435754189944134078212291%;
	top:55.930355198806793023201616688917%;
	width:20.670391061452513966480446927374%;
	
	}	


.Recommend .video ul li .time-bg{
	width:100%;
	}	
.Recommend .video ul .time-num{
	font-size:8px;
	}

}